Dharmawantsyou.com is a website launched as part of the presumed new Lost alternate reality game running during the hiatus between Seasons 4 and 5. A newsletter email from Octagon Global Recruiting identified the site as a place where volunteers may be assessed for their eligibility to join their project. It has been stated that this will be available for a limited time only, though the specifics are not yet known.

The site opened fully on July 29th, allowing fans to take the online test.

From the "What Is This" section of DharmaWantsYou.com:

Dharma Wants You is an online experience connected to the ABC TV show LOST.

The story follows a fictitious scientific community from LOST, The Dharma Initiative, as it attempts to recruit and assess volunteers for a secret research project.

By completing an 'Eligibility Test' and registering on dharmawantsyou.com audience members enroll as volunteer recruits for the Dharma Initiative.

Each week audience members will have the opportunity to complete a test that assesses their abilities in a particular skill.

Comic Con

Dharma IDcard

After taking the aptitude test as part of the Octagon Global Recruiting drive, participants were given an ID card with a code on the back. This can be entered on the Dharmawantsyou.com website to enter "phase 2" of the application process. Flyers given out at Comic Con also reiterated that if you cannot get an appointment in person, applications can be made online from July 28th.

"Coming Soon"

DHARMA butterfly2

The first set of black dots.

  • In the weeks leading up to the site's launch, its homepage displayed only the phrase, "DHARMA WANTS YOU: Coming Soon", with small dots incrementally appearing on a daily basis to form an octagon identical to that which was advertised at Comic Con as the Initiative's new logo.
Dharmawantsyoudots

By July 28th, all the dots had been included, outlining the DHARMA logo.

  • This new logo uses a different method to display the same eight trigrams seen in the original one; instead of 3 sets of lines, solid shapes are used. However, the trigrams are not arranged in the same order as in the standard logo: the new one is rotated one quarter-turn clockwise.

Launch

Dharmawantsyou.com launched on July 29th for most time zones, a day later than originally planned.

Upon entry to the site, a short intro is played rhetorically questioning your desire to establish a better tomorrow. Afterwards, the main page presents three options: to register as a new user, to log in as a previously registered used, or to register as a user having been present at Comic Con. There is also a small menu in the top left of the page, displaying three additional links: Home, About Us, and Login. Along the bottom of the page is information regarding ABC and other legal terms.

The message's webpage source code contained two clues:

  • "Banks claw," an anagram which translates to "Black Swan." The Black Swan theory describes a highly random and unpredictable event, the term being derived from the ancient Western conception that 'All swans are white.' In that context, 'black swan' is a metaphor for something that could not exist. Some examples of a Black Swan event include the Internet and the 9/11 attacks.
  • A YouTube link to the "Bluetooth Video" from Comic Con, rendered in high-quality. The uploading user is in fact RuckusGuy.

Test

DWY passed

Upon test completion.

Participants who first sign up must take a test to determine if they can "pass". (It is likely that all recruits, in fact, pass as part of the ARG.) After the test is completed, the recruit must create and configure an account by entering certain personal information. Once this is done, the new user can then check their own Progress, view the Top 10 Recruits on a Leaderboard, or view their own Profile. Recruitment assessments are said to begin soon.

During the test, the background audio loop contains an Icelandic phrase, spoken repeatedly by a woman. She says: [1]

Þeir sem koma að dharmaverkefninu munu þurfa ferðast yfir hafið um langan veg á umtalsverðum hraða. Vinnan mun fela í sér útiveru og líkamlegt athæfi. Þú munt jafnvel einnig geta upplifað [óstöðleika á tímanum á samfylgdinni]. Vonandi ert þú sem og margir sem finnst vinnan mikilvægari en persónulegt öryggi þitt.

Those who come to the Dharma Initiative must be transported a long way across the sea at a considerable speed. Work will include being outdoors and physical labour. You may also experience some instability of time along the way. Hopefully you, like many others, feel that your social duty is more important than your personal safety.

Trivia

  • Question 13 could be construed to be a reference to Blade Runner. The nature of the hypotheticals mirror that of the Voight-Kampff tests.
  • In the registration form, the default date of birth is 17th July, 1978. That is approximately (perhaps exactly) the time the Dharma booth video is supposed to have been made. The default gender is also female, which may reference the woman named "Jennifer" in the DHARMA video.
